How to connect ReachInbox and Google Cloud Text-To-Speech

Create a New Scenario to Connect ReachInbox and Google Cloud Text-To-Speech

In the workspace, click the “Create New Scenario” button.

Add the First Step

Add the first node – a trigger that will initiate the scenario when it receives the required event. Triggers can be scheduled, called by a ReachInbox, triggered by another scenario, or executed manually (for testing purposes). In most cases, ReachInbox or Google Cloud Text-To-Speech will be your first step. To do this, click "Choose an app," find ReachInbox or Google Cloud Text-To-Speech, and select the appropriate trigger to start the scenario.

Add the ReachInbox Node

Select the ReachInbox node from the app selection panel on the right.

Save and Activate the Scenario

After configuring ReachInbox, Google Cloud Text-To-Speech, and any additional nodes, don’t forget to save the scenario and click "Deploy." Activating the scenario ensures it will run automatically whenever the trigger node receives input or a condition is met. By default, all newly created scenarios are deactivated.

Test the Scenario

Run the scenario by clicking “Run once” and triggering an event to check if the ReachInbox and Google Cloud Text-To-Speech integration works as expected. Depending on your setup, data should flow between ReachInbox and Google Cloud Text-To-Speech (or vice versa). Easily troubleshoot the scenario by reviewing the execution history to identify and fix any issues.

Are there any limitations to the ReachInbox and Google Cloud Text-To-Speech integration on Latenode?

While the integration is powerful, there are certain limitations to be aware of:

  • Google Cloud Text-To-Speech pricing is separate and depends on usage volume.
  • Voice customization options are determined by Google Cloud Text-To-Speech features.
  • ReachInbox API rate limits may affect the speed of processing large volumes.
